{"id":5484,"date":"2016-01-28T11:45:19","date_gmt":"2016-01-28T19:45:19","guid":{"rendered":"http:\/\/www.dognmonkey.com\/techs\/?p=5484"},"modified":"2017-11-14T10:42:19","modified_gmt":"2017-11-14T18:42:19","slug":"shortcodes-for-boostrap-collapsible","status":"publish","type":"post","link":"https:\/\/www.dognmonkey.com\/techs\/shortcodes-for-boostrap-collapsible.html","title":{"rendered":"Shortcodes For Boostrap Collapsible"},"content":{"rendered":"<p style=\"text-align: center;\"><a class=\"preview\" href=\"\/\/www.dognmonkey.com\/techs\/wp-content\/uploads\/2016\/01\/bs_full.jpg\" rel=\"lightbox[bs]\"><img loading=\"lazy\" decoding=\"async\" class=\"alignnone size-thumbnail wp-image-5491\" src=\"\/\/www.dognmonkey.com\/techs\/wp-content\/uploads\/2016\/01\/bs_full-200x112.jpg\" alt=\"bs_full\" width=\"200\" height=\"112\" \/><\/a> \u00a0 <a class=\"preview\" href=\"\/\/www.dognmonkey.com\/techs\/wp-content\/uploads\/2016\/01\/bs_full1.jpg\" rel=\"lightbox[bs]\"><img loading=\"lazy\" decoding=\"async\" class=\"alignnone size-thumbnail wp-image-5492\" src=\"\/\/www.dognmonkey.com\/techs\/wp-content\/uploads\/2016\/01\/bs_full1-200x86.jpg\" alt=\"bs_full1\" width=\"200\" height=\"86\" \/><\/a><\/p>\n<p>[bs]<\/p>\n<p style=\"text-align: left;\">I like to use Bootstrap for my blogs, so I created a few shortcodes for collapsible and link buttons when I need to use them.<\/p>\n<p style=\"text-align: center;\">[mybs data=&#8221;1&#8243; title=&#8221;this is title1&#8243;]1. Lorem ipsum dolor sit amet, consectetur adipisicing elit,[\/mybs]<\/p>\n<p style=\"text-align: center;\">[mybs data=&#8221;2&#8243; title=&#8221;this is title2&#8243;]2. Lorem ipsum dolor sit amet, consectetur adipisicing elit,[\/mybs]<\/p>\n<p style=\"text-align: center;\">[mybs data=&#8221;3&#8243; title=&#8221;this is title3&#8243;]3. Lorem ipsum dolor sit amet, consectetur adipisicing elit,[\/mybs]<\/p>\n<blockquote><p>add_shortcode( &#8216;mybs&#8217;, &#8216;mybs_func&#8217; );<br \/>\nfunction mybs_func($atts, $content = null) {<br \/>\nextract(shortcode_atts(array(<br \/>\n&#8216;data&#8217; =&gt; &#8221;,<br \/>\n&#8216;title&#8217; =&gt;&#8221;,<br \/>\n), $atts));<br \/>\nreturn<br \/>\n&#8216;&#8221;&lt; &#8220;button class=&#8221;btn btn-info&#8221; type=&#8221;button&#8221; data-toggle=&#8221;collapse&#8221; data-target=&#8221;&#8216;.&#8217;#&#8217;.$atts[&#8216;data&#8217;].'&#8221;&gt;&#8217;.$atts[&#8216;title&#8217;].&#8221;.<br \/>\n&#8216;<br \/>\n&#8220;&lt; &#8220;div id=&#8221;&#8216;.$atts[&#8216;data&#8217;].'&#8221; class=&#8221;collapse&#8221;&gt;&#8217;.$content.'&lt; &#8220;\/&#8221;div&gt;<br \/>\n&#8216;<br \/>\n; }<\/p>\n<p>add_shortcode( &#8216;bs&#8217;, &#8216;bsscript&#8217; );<br \/>\nfunction bsscript() {<br \/>\nreturn<br \/>\n&#8216;<script src=\"https:\/\/ajax.googleapis.com\/ajax\/libs\/jquery\/1.11.3\/jquery.min.js\"><\/script><br \/>\n<script src=\"\/\/maxcdn.bootstrapcdn.com\/bootstrap\/3.3.5\/js\/bootstrap.min.js\"><\/script>&#8216;<br \/>\n; }<\/p>\n<p>include &#8216;bs_full.php&#8217;; in function.php<br \/>\nuse shortcode [&#8220;bs] to load the bs scripts<br \/>\nuse shortcode [&#8220;mybs data=&#8221;0&#8243; title=&#8221;blahblah&#8221;]content[&#8220;\/mybs]<\/p><\/blockquote>\n<p style=\"text-align: center;\">Make button links with different color display.<\/p>\n<p style=\"text-align: center;\"><a href=\"\/\/www.dognmonkey.com\/techs\" target=\"_blank\" rel=\"noopener\">technologies today<\/a><\/p>\n<blockquote><p>&lt;a href=&#8221;\/\/www.dognmonkey.com\/techs&#8221;&gt;[ bsblue]technologies today[\/bsblue ]&lt;\/a&gt;<\/p>\n<p>add_shortcode( &#8216;bsblue&#8217;, &#8216;bsbutton2&#8217; );<br \/>\nfunction bsbutton2($atts, $content = null) {<br \/>\nextract(shortcode_atts(array(<br \/>\n&#8216;data&#8217; =&gt; &#8221;,<br \/>\n), $atts));<br \/>\nreturn<br \/>\n&#8216;&lt;button type=&#8221;button&#8221; class=&#8221;btn btn-primary&#8221;&gt;&#8217;.$content.'&lt;\/button&gt;&#8217;<br \/>\n; }<\/p><\/blockquote>\n<p>&nbsp;<\/p>\n<p style=\"text-align: center;\"><a href=\"\/\/www.dognmonkey.com\/techs\" target=\"_blank\" rel=\"noopener\">technologies today<\/a><\/p>\n<blockquote><p>&lt;a href=&#8221;\/\/www.dognmonkey.com\/techs&#8221;&gt;[ bsred]technologies today[\/bsred ]&lt;\/a&gt;<\/p>\n<p>add_shortcode( &#8216;bsred&#8217;, &#8216;bsbutton1&#8217; );<br \/>\nfunction bsbutton1($atts, $content = null) {<br \/>\nextract(shortcode_atts(array(<br \/>\n&#8216;data&#8217; =&gt; &#8221;,<br \/>\n), $atts));<br \/>\nreturn<br \/>\n&#8216;&lt;button type=&#8221;button&#8221; class=&#8221;btn btn-danger&#8221;&gt;&#8217;.$content.'&lt;\/button&gt;&#8217;<br \/>\n; }<\/p><\/blockquote>\n<p>&nbsp;<\/p>\n<p style=\"text-align: center;\"><a href=\"\/\/www.dognmonkey.com\/techs\" target=\"_blank\" rel=\"noopener\">technologies today<\/a><\/p>\n<blockquote><p>&lt;a href=&#8221;\/\/www.dognmonkey.com\/techs&#8221;&gt;[ bsgreen]technologies today[\/bsgreen ]&lt;\/a&gt;<\/p>\n<p>add_shortcode( &#8216;bsgreen&#8217;, &#8216;bsbutton3&#8217; );<br \/>\nfunction bsbutton3($atts, $content = null) {<br \/>\nextract(shortcode_atts(array(<br \/>\n&#8216;data&#8217; =&gt; &#8221;,<br \/>\n), $atts));<br \/>\nreturn<br \/>\n&#8216;&lt;button type=&#8221;button&#8221; class=&#8221;btn btn-success&#8221;&gt;&#8217;.$content.'&lt;\/button&gt;&#8217;<br \/>\n; }<\/p><\/blockquote>\n<ul class=\"lcp_catlist\" id=\"lcp_instance_0\"><\/ul>\n","protected":false},"excerpt":{"rendered":"<p>\u00a0 [bs] I like to use Bootstrap for my blogs, so I created a few shortcodes for collapsible and link buttons when I need to use them. [mybs data=&#8221;1&#8243; title=&#8221;this is title1&#8243;]1. Lorem ipsum dolor sit amet, consectetur adipisicing elit,[\/mybs] [mybs data=&#8221;2&#8243; title=&#8221;this is title2&#8243;]2. Lorem ipsum dolor sit amet, consectetur adipisicing elit,[\/mybs] [mybs data=&#8221;3&#8243; <a href=\"https:\/\/www.dognmonkey.com\/techs\/shortcodes-for-boostrap-collapsible.html\" class=\"more-link\">&#8230;<\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[807,20],"tags":[799,804,803],"class_list":["post-5484","post","type-post","status-publish","format-standard","hentry","category-scripts","category-wordpress","tag-bootstrap-collapsible","tag-responsive","tag-shortcodes"],"views":257,"_links":{"self":[{"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/posts\/5484","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/comments?post=5484"}],"version-history":[{"count":4,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/posts\/5484\/revisions"}],"predecessor-version":[{"id":6594,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/posts\/5484\/revisions\/6594"}],"wp:attachment":[{"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/media?parent=5484"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/categories?post=5484"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.dognmonkey.com\/techs\/wp-json\/wp\/v2\/tags?post=5484"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}